NiFe‐NO3 Layered Double Hydroxide as a Novel Anode for Sodium Ion Batteries

open access: yesBatteries &Supercaps, Volume 8, Issue 3, March 2025.
This study demonstrates, for the first time, the effectiveness of using LDH as an anodic material in SIB. The material is stable and show high specific capacity, the reaction mechanism has been thoroughly investigated and comprehensively described and involves a phase change reaction followed by sodium intercalation.

Capacitor to Supercapacitor [PDF]

open access: possible, 2020
Supercapacitors bridge the gap between conventional electrolytic capacitors and batteries. These are capacitors with electrochemical charge storage. The basic equations used to describe the capacitors are same in the case of supercapacitors but their mechanism of energy storage is different.
